Smart Battery Workshop is a niche utility used to communicate with the integrated circuits (ICs) found inside laptop batteries. These "smart" chips monitor health, cycle counts, and temperature. However, manufacturers often design these chips with "permanent failure" flags. Once a battery reaches a certain age or cycle count, the chip locks it down—often rendering perfectly good lithium-ion cells useless for the sake of safety (or, as critics argue, planned obsolescence). Smart Battery Workshop 3.71 is a specialized Windows-based utility designed to repair and restore laptop batteries by modifying the data stored in their EEPROM (Electrically Erasable Programmable Read-Only Memory) chips. Key Functions

The software allows users to access the internal memory of a laptop battery to perform several critical maintenance tasks:

Reset Cycle Count: It can reset the charge cycle count to zero, making the battery appear "new" to the laptop system.

Modify Capacity Data: Users can update the "Full Charge Capacity" to reflect the actual capacity of replaced internal cells.

Clear Failure Flags: It can clear "Permanent Failure" (PF) flags that might otherwise lock a battery and prevent it from charging or discharging.

Date Updates: The software can change the manufacturing date to the current repair date. Technical Requirements

Using Smart Battery Workshop is a technical process that typically requires more than just software:

Hardware Interface: It requires a hardware adapter (such as a Philips Standard I2C Parallel Port Adapter) to connect the battery chip to a computer.

Chip Handling: In some cases, the developers recommend unsoldering the EEPROM chip from the battery board to connect it directly to the adapter for reading/writing.

Knowledge: It is designed for users with experience in handling EEPROM chips and basic electronic components. Risks and Considerations

Safety: Modifying battery parameters incorrectly can lead to physical damage or safety hazards, as lithium-ion batteries are sensitive to charging parameters.

Warranty: Using this software to tinker with internal battery chips will likely void any existing manufacturer warranty.

Security Risks: Be cautious of "crack" versions or "full" versions (like "Smart Battery Workshop 3.71 crack 30") found on unofficial sites. These files frequently contain malware or viruses that can compromise your computer's security.

Licensing: Legitimate versions of this professional software were originally sold for approximately $159.95, though it is now largely considered legacy software. Smart Battery Workshop 3.71 Crack - Facebook

Understanding Smart Battery Technology

To appreciate the utility of software like Smart Battery Workshop, one must first understand the complexity of modern "smart" batteries. Unlike standard alkaline cells, a smart battery contains a small microchip known as the Battery Management System (BMS). This chip monitors critical parameters such as voltage, current, temperature, and state of charge. It communicates with the host device (usually a laptop) via the System Management Bus (SMBus).

When a battery fails, it is often not because the chemical cells are completely depleted, but because the BMS has locked the battery due to a safety flag, an error in its firmware, or a desynchronization between the reported capacity and the actual capacity. This is where diagnostic software becomes indispensable.

The Function of Smart Battery Workshop

Smart Battery Workshop is a tool utilized by technicians to communicate directly with the BMS via the SMBus protocol. Its legitimate primary functions include reading static data (like the manufacturer and chemistry), cycling the battery to recalibrate the capacity reporting, and, crucially, resetting the "smart" chip.

For example, if a user replaces the worn-out lithium cells in a battery pack with new ones, the old BMS may still remember the previous failure state. Without resetting the chip, the "new" battery will not charge or function. The software allows technicians to clear these fault codes and reset the cycle count, effectively reviving the battery pack. This process supports the "right to repair" movement by extending the lifespan of hardware and reducing electronic waste.

The Risks of Unauthorized Software

The search terms surrounding "Smart Battery Workshop 3.71 crack" indicate a demand for this utility without the associated cost of a commercial license. However, using cracked software in this specific context carries significant risks that go beyond typical software piracy.

First, safety is a paramount concern. Interfacing with lithium-ion battery management systems requires precision. A cracked version of diagnostic software may contain corrupted code or malware that could send incorrect commands to the BMS. If a BMS is incorrectly programmed, it can fail to detect overcurrent or overheating conditions. In the worst-case scenario, this could lead to thermal runaway, resulting in fire or explosion.

Second, cracked software offers no technical support. Battery configurations vary widely between manufacturers (e.g., Texas Instruments chips versus Maxim Integrated chips). Official software is frequently updated to support new BMS protocols. A cracked version of an older build (such as 3.71) would lack support for modern hardware, rendering it useless for newer devices and potentially bricking the batteries of older devices due to incompatibility.
